Latest Patents
One of Subklewe's latest patents is a trispecific molecule that combines specific tumor targeting with local immune checkpoint inhibition. This invention relates to a novel molecule that comprises three binding sites, each with specificity for a tumor cell, an effector cell, and a checkpoint molecule, respectively. Additionally, the invention includes a pharmaceutical composition that utilizes this molecule and outlines its various applications.
Another significant patent involves the administration of a bispecific construct that binds to CD33 and CD3 for the treatment of myeloid leukemia. This invention provides a bispecific construct that includes a first binding domain specifically targeting CD33 and a second binding domain specifically targeting CD3. The method described allows for the administration of this construct for a maximum period of 14 days, followed by a 14-day period without administration. Furthermore, the invention details a method for treating myeloid leukemia using a therapeutically efficient amount of this bispecific construct.
Career Highlights
Throughout his career, Marion Subklewe has worked with prominent organizations, including Amgen Research GmbH and Ludwig-Maximilians-Universität München. His experience in these institutions has allowed him to collaborate on groundbreaking research and development projects.
Collaborations
Subklewe has collaborated with notable colleagues, including Karl-Peter Hopfner and Nadine Magauer. These partnerships have contributed to the advancement of his research and the successful development of his patented inventions.
